Abstract

The invention discloses a kind of air cleaning system of circulation cyclone dust removal, including:Inlet air filter bank, its lower end are provided with top passageway;Whirlwind mixing arrangement, it is disposed in the interior in side wall interlayer, and the arrival end of the whirlwind mixing arrangement is connected with the upper end of the top passageway, and the whirlwind mixing arrangement port of export is connected with the top passageway;Air-washer, the indoor return air after whirlwind mixing arrangement processing are transmitted in the air-washer;First return air filter, it is disposed in the interior bottom center, and first return air filter is connected with the air inlet of air handling system;And second return air filter, it is disposed in the interior two bottom sides, and room air is transferred directly in the whirlwind mixing arrangement by second return air filter after treatment.The present invention solves the technical problem that the net occupied space of air cleaning system is big, treatment effeciency is low.

As shown in Figs. 1-2, the present invention provides a kind of air cleaning system of circulation cyclone dust removal, including:Inlet air filter Group, whirlwind mixing arrangement, air-washer, the first return air filter and the second return air filter.
Wherein, inlet air filter bank 21, its top being disposed in the interior, the inlet air filter bank and air handling system Air outlet connection, obtained air after 21 high efficiency filter of inlet air filter bank by being transported to room after air handling system processing Interior top, it is generally the case that inlet air filter bank 21 is disposed in the interior the centre at top, or sets several inlet air mistakes Filter group 21 is arranged in indoor ceiling, and 21 lower end of inlet air filter bank is provided with top passageway 20;
Whirlwind mixing arrangement 30, it is disposed in the interior in side wall interlayer, specifically, being offered back in the indoor side wall Wind passage 16, the bottom of the return air channel 16 are connected with indoor bottom, and the whirlwind mixing arrangement returns about 30 through described Wind passage, the return air of indoor bottom output enter the bottom of whirlwind mixing arrangement 30 from return air channel bottom, are mixed by whirlwind Attach together after putting the processing of 30 coalescences, exported from upper end, enter top passageway, in the present embodiment, the whirlwind mixing arrangement 30 is matched somebody with somebody Cylindrical empty cavity configuration is set to, the cylindrical cavity inner height direction is provided with helical blade, and return air is passed into the whirlwind In 30 cylindrical cavity of mixing arrangement, by the effect of helical blade, mixing is rotated in cylindrical cavity, in the process, carefully Small dust constantly collides coalescence into the dust of bulky grain, while the outwardly setting on the cylindrical empty chamber inner sidewall There are several dust-collecting cavities 12, each dust-collecting cavity can be opened to indoor extension, elongated end, the powder being convenient to clean in dust-collecting cavity Dirt, since dust is constantly rotated along the direction of helical blade in cylindrical empty intracavitary, the dust of larger particles is in centrifugal force Move out, gathered in the dust-collecting cavity under effect, after aggregation to a certain extent, dust-collecting cavity can be cleared up, will be poly- Collection dust in dust-collecting cavity is cleaned to outdoor, and to ensure the ability of the collection dust of dust-collecting cavity, it is defeated to reduce whirlwind mixing arrangement 30 Go out the dust content in return air;The whirlwind mixing arrangement port of export is connected with the top passageway;
Air-washer 40, it is arranged on interior of the top passageway side after whirlwind mixing arrangement processing and returns Hearsay is sent into the air-washer, and the bottom of the air-washer is provided with return flow line, and the air-washer includes interior set The housing of cavity and several shower plates 42 drawn from the housing into cavity, are provided with storage in the interlayer of the housing Sap cavity 41, the arrival end of the cavity are connected with the port of export of the return air channel, and the liquid storage cylinder 41 is filled with outdoor feed flow Put connection, the liquid feed device can within be provided with the aqueous solution containing air purifying preparation, the shower plate 42 is arranged at intervals successively A bending half-duplex channel is formed in the upper and lower ends of the housing, the return air after 30 charged processing of charge device, which is transported to, to be washed In device of air 40, exported after the half-duplex channel formed via shower plate 42, accommodating cavity, institute are provided with the shower plate interlayer State and several nozzles connected with the accommodating cavity are offered in shower plate both side surface, from two neighboring shower plate nozzle The liquid of ejection forms water curtain, and the bottom of the air-washer offers several through holes connected with the return flow line, sprays Larger dust after aqueous solution and coalescence that leaching plate 42 sprays is deposited on housing bottom after coming into full contact with, and is returned to by the through hole Into the return flow line, the dust in return air is effectively filtered out, and the aqueous solution in return flow line is through multiple times of filtration and sterilization After processing, it is back in the liquid feed device and reuses.Also, the upper end of the housing internal cavity is arranged at intervals with several Cation generator, the water droplet sprayed by nozzle have positive charge, negatively charged dust charge positively charged by cation generator lotus There is a natural attraction between the sexes for the water droplet of lotus, and small liquid is combined into larger particle with dust, as the sedimentation of water droplet is deposited in aqueous, So as to reduce dust content in return air;
First return air filter 22, it is disposed in the interior bottom center, first return air filter 22 and air adjustment Indoor outmoded gas is extracted out, partly directed out by the air inlet connection of system, the first return air filter 22 from indoor bottom Discharge, partly carries out filtration treatment by the first return air filter 22, is sent in air handling system and is handled after processing, It is sent to together in inlet air filter bank 21 with new air after processing, realizes the effective recycling of resource, reduce gap The energy consumption of regulating system;And
Second return air filter 23, it is disposed in the interior two bottom sides, specifically, the two of first return air filter 22 Side is respectively arranged with second return air filter 23, and second return air filter is straight after treatment by room air Connect and be transmitted in the whirlwind mixing arrangement, increase the regeneration amount of return air, whole air cleaning system can be effectively reduced With the energy consumption of air handling system, the bottom of the whirlwind mixing arrangement is connected with the port of export of second return air filter, The upper end of the whirlwind mixing arrangement is connected by the regeneration wind turbine 15 with the arrival end of the whirlwind mixing arrangement.
Indoor return air enters return air channel from indoor bottom, after the processing of whirlwind mixing arrangement, from return air channel Upper end enter in the air-washer in top passageway, the dust in return air through collision coalescence processing after, carry out gas washing processing, Wash the dust in return air off, the port of export of the air-washer is connected with the air outlet of inlet air filter bank, is formed one and is collected Area, be then arranged on by being covered with the top passageway lower end current equalizer 11 it is balanced enter interior.
